Martin v. Löwis wrote:
>>> Yes, an XML parser should be able to use UTF-8, UTF-16, UTF-32, etc
>>> codecs to do the encoding. There's no need to create a magical
>>> mystery codec to pick out which though.
>> So the code is good, if it is inside an XML parser, and it's bad if it
>> is inside a codec?
>
> Exactly so. This functionality just *isn't* a codec - there is no
> encoding. Instead, it is an algorithm for *detecting* an encoding.
And what do you do once you've detected the encoding? You decode the
input, so why not combine both into an XML decoder?
